OpenAI in Acquisition Talks to Buy Codeium for $3B, Competing with AI Coding Assistants
OpenAI is reportedly negotiating to acquire Codeium, the creator of the AI coding assistant Windsurf, for approximately $3 billion. This potential acquisition could position OpenAI against other coding assistant companies like Anysphere's Cursor, which it previously supported through its Startup Fund. The move raises concerns about the integrity of the Startup Fund, given its investment in Cursor. Windsurf users have received emails hinting at a significant announcement, while OpenAI's product chief recently praised Windsurf. Codeium, founded in 2021, has raised $243 million and reported $40 million in annual recurring revenue.

BluSmart Suspends Service Amid Gensol Engineering Probe
BluSmart, India's electric cab-hailing startup, has suspended its services in major cities as the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) investigates Gensol Engineering, which shares co-founders with BluSmart. The suspension comes after allegations that the co-founders misused substantial loan amounts for personal expenses. Customers have reported issues accessing funds in their BluSmart wallets. Despite earlier success, with substantial ARR and fleet growth, the board has not communicated updates to investors. Gensol clarified it is not pursuing any significant transactions despite market speculation about a partnership with Uber.

Startup Funding Surges to $91.5 Billion in Q1 Amid Grim 2025 Outlook
U.S. startups secured $91.5 billion in venture capital funding during the first quarter, marking an 18.5% increase from the previous quarter and the second-highest quarterly total in a decade, according to PitchBook. However, Kyle Stanford, PitchBook's lead U.S. venture capital analyst, warns of a bleak future for 2025, citing disappointing IPO expectations and economic uncertainties linked to stock market volatility and trade policies. Notably, 44% of the funding was concentrated in OpenAI's $40 billion round, raising concerns about the overall health of the startup ecosystem. Many startups may face down rounds or acquisitions at reduced valuations as economic pressures mount.

Lyft Acquires FREENOW for $197M, Expanding into Europe
Lyft has announced its acquisition of FREENOW, a German multi-mobility app, for approximately $197 million in cash, marking its entry into the European market. This strategic move will significantly expand Lyft's reach, which has been limited to the U.S. and Canada since its inception in 2012. FREENOW operates in nine countries, including key markets like Germany and the UK. The merger is expected to increase Lyft’s addressable market and annualized gross bookings substantially. Both companies aim for a seamless integration of services for riders across North America and Europe.

New Tool Evaluates AI Chatbot Responses to Controversial Topics
A developer, known as 'xlr8harder', has launched a tool named SpeechMap to assess how AI chatbots like ChatGPT and Grok handle sensitive subjects. This initiative comes amid criticisms claiming that these models are overly 'woke' and censor conservative viewpoints. SpeechMap analyzes compliance with various prompts, revealing that OpenAI's models increasingly avoid political questions. In contrast, Grok 3 by Elon Musk's xAI shows a higher compliance rate, responding to 96.2% of prompts. The developer encourages public discourse on AI model limitations and bias, highlighting the need for transparency in AI development.

US Government Imposes Export License on Nvidia's H20 AI Chips
Nvidia faces new U.S. export controls requiring a license for its H20 AI chips to China, citing concerns over potential supercomputer use. The indefinite license requirement could lead to $5.5 billion in charges for Nvidia in Q1 2026. The H20 chips are critical to the company, and their restricted export follows allegations of usage by China's DeepSeek AI startup. Despite a recent commitment to invest in U.S. AI manufacturing, Nvidia's stock fell 6% in after-hours trading. The situation highlights rising tensions between U.S. and Chinese technology sectors.

India's BluSmart Entangled in Gensol's EV Loan Misuse Investigation
India's market regulator is investigating Gensol Engineering for alleged misuse of electric vehicle loans, implicating BluSmart, a ride-hailing startup co-founded by Gensol's founders.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) has barred Anmol and Puneet Singh Jaggi from key roles as they investigate claims of redirected funds for personal use. Gensol reportedly defaulted on loans intended for purchasing EVs for BluSmart. Meanwhile, BluSmart faces challenges with cash burns and has shut down its Dubai service, exploring new strategies to sustain operations in India.

Pacific Fusion Unveils Revolutionary Fusion Power Plant Plans
Pacific Fusion has announced its ambitious plans to build a fusion power plant, revealing a detailed technical roadmap. Co-founder Will Regan highlighted the project's potential to achieve 100 times the energy gain of existing facilities at a fraction of the cost. Utilizing innovative technology, the startup will generate electricity through 156 pulser modules to facilitate fusion reactions. While the first commercial reactor is a decade away, Pacific Fusion is ahead of schedule with prototypes developed. The startup's $900 million Series A funding will support their next steps in this groundbreaking initiative.
